Callers Share Heartwarming Memories of Their First Bikes
The popular radio show *In My Day*, hosted by Roman, recently invited listeners to share their cherished memories of their first bicycles. During the show, participants called in to recount stories that ranged from exciting adventures to fond recollections of childhood. The segment captured the nostalgia of biking, highlighting the emotional connections many have with their first rides.
Listeners responded enthusiastically, contributing a wealth of heartwarming anecdotes. Several callers described their first bicycles, often detailing the unique features that made their bikes special. Some focused on the joy of receiving their bikes, while others reminisced about the freedom and independence that came with riding for the first time.
In one memorable call, a listener shared how their first bike was a vibrant red model, complete with a shiny bell. They recalled the thrill of learning to ride it without training wheels, a milestone that symbolized growing up. Another caller described a hand-me-down bike that had been passed through generations, emphasizing the sentimental value it held for their family.
